Interior designers are in demand not just to decorate homes and apartments, but also exhibitions, showrooms and office space. Every week, the real estate pages of the daily newspapers are full of large and attractive pictures of exotic structures, buildings, homes, offices and new and innovative urban complexes each displayed in aesthetic ways. Today, when you buy a home or an office, you don't only get a shell structure, most often the interior space will also have been handled in a creative manner.

Students can refer the steps given below to complete the Chandigarh University admissions:
- Apply and register for CUCET at the official CU website.
- Choose an examination date for the Chandigarh University Eligibility and Scholarship Test as per your convenience.
- After the CUCET results are out, students can submit their applications for admission and availing the merit-based scholarship.
Students need to submit some documents at the time of Chandigarh University admissions. A list of important documents is as below:
- Class 10 marksheet
- Class 12 marksheet
- UG marksheet - for PG admissions
- PG marksheet - if applicable
- DOB Certificate/ Aadhaar Card
- Passport-size photograph
- Transfer certificate
- Character certificate
- Migration Certificate
Yes, CUCET is compulsory for Chandigarh University admissions. The university conducts the CUCET test for both scholarships and admissions to its courses. The test is conducted for courses in the fields of Engineering, Archcitecture, Law, Pharmacy, etc. Students with valid NEET/ NATA/ JEE scores can get admission into the BOptom, BPT, BArch courses without appearing for CUCET.
Chandigarh University (CU) admissions are generally based on CUCET scores for most of the courses. Students need to appear for the test or submit scores of any other accepted exams as stated by the university. Hence, in some cases, you may get admission in CU without CUCET. The CUCET test is also a scholarship test and if you want to get the scholarship benefits offered by the university based on CUCET scores, then you will have to appear for the exam.
